Skinny and pregnant Simple Life star Nicole Richie pleaded guilty to charges of driving under the influence of drugs and was sentenced to four days in jail, just a month after TV co-star it, finished her 3 week stint behind bars.
Nicole has been ordered to serve her time by the 28th September, but it’s not clear when or where she would be jailed. The socialite also has to pay a fine over $2,000, was ordered to enroll in a court-supervised rehabilitation program and has been placed on three years probation.
Lionel Richie’s daughter didn’t face court alone, she was accompanied by bodyguards and her boyfriend, Good Charlotte’s Joel Madden.
Steven Lubell, Superior Court Commissioner warned Nicole Richie twice, that she could end up doing 12 months behind bars if she violates her probation.
Steven Lubell said:
“The court views this plea agreement as a contract. If you violate the terms of this agreement, you can and you will go to county jail for more time than the court is giving you today. Being under the influence of alcohol or drugs while driving is extremely dangerous.”
The only words Nicole Richie spoke during the hearing was “guilty” when asked how she pleaded, and “yes” when asked if she acknowledged her previous conviction.
Nicole did not speak to any of the media leaving court, she quickly and quietly left in a black SUV.
